As far as the stock market goes, it is falling because of the systems in place right now. All the big players are always leveraged to the hilt and now have to hit their margin calls much sooner than in the past to make sure they can make them which is now a government regulation. With the Corona Virus, people have stopped travel and we are a world economy so that effects the market. So when the market falls a little bit now and margin calls come do, these guys have to sell to make the margin call which leads to larger sell offs so others can make their margin call and it just tumbles. It is a two edged sword. Nobody should need a bail out if they follow these regulations, but the market is tumbling directly because of these regulations. The only thing I see is having to pay more in taxes and having more of my freedoms and choices taken away. Here is a perfect example of a liberal policy I am dealing with right now. As of March 1st I can't give plastic bags out anymore. I can charge whatever I want for paper bags but I have to pay the State 5 cents for paper bags I sell. The law requires that I put single beers in a paper bag. The price of a single beer just went up 5 cents and I get nothing from it. What nobody can seem to answer either is, how am I required to track how many paper bags I have sold. Do I have to keep an inventory of paper bags like I do for tobacco products? How do I pay someone to do this or do I just add it to my plate? When do I make this payment, once a year, when I pay monthly sales tax? Nobody knows, they just made a law without any thought as to how it would affect the people that have to deal with it or what it would cost them. For no other reason than it makes the green people happy and they get to collect some money. If it wasn't a money grab they could easily make us bio degradable plastic bags like the ones I use to clean up after my dog.
